Todd is a graduate of Daniel Webster College with a Bachelor of Science in Aviation Operations and a multi-engine commercial pilot’s license. In addition, he has earned several professional certifications, including a Construction Supervisor’s License, Hydraulics License, and PHIUS Certification. Todd serves as President of the Home Builders & Remodelers Association of Cape Cod, a role he assumed in December 2025, after previously serving two years as Vice President. He is also a board member of Falmouth Community Television.
Todd is active in the local community as a town meeting member in Falmouth, MA, where he resides with his wife, Stacy, and their two daughters. He is a member of the Falmouth Rod & Gun Club, and his hobbies include boating, fishing, snowmobiling, and playing lacrosse.
